How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Grant County?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Grant County Studio Apartments | $725 | $725 | $725 |
| Grant County 1 Bedroom Apartments | $807 | $500 | $1,115 |
| Grant County 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,256 | $795 | $2,100 |
| Grant County 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,198 | $1,000 | $1,700 |
| Grant County 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,722 | $1,495 | $1,800 |

Frequently Asked Questions about 2 Bedroom Grant County Apartments
How much is the average rent for a 2 Bedroom Grant County Apartment?
The average rent for a 2 Bedroom Apartment in Grant County is $1,256.
What is the largest available 2 Bedroom Grant County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Grant County is a 1,210 square feet unit starting from $2,100 at Loras Estates.
